The image best reflects the influence of nature on Japanese culture by showing buildings being in harmony with the environment. The presence of Mount Fuji, a significant and inspirational natural landmark, alongside a Shinto temple, demonstrates the cultural reverence for nature in Japan. The integration of the temple with the surrounding greenery and water highlights the traditional Japanese aesthetic that emphasizes harmony between human-made structures and the natural world. This connection to nature is a fundamental aspect of Shinto beliefs, which regard natural elements as sacred.
